Copy XXIX of 30 SPECIAL copies printed on handmade paper with the additional suite of plates , for a total of 33, all signed by the artists apart from the Kennington and the Underwood prints (as is usual). The Apocrypha, bound in full black vellum over boards, edges a little rubbed, spine with gilt title. Internally, limitation leaf, half title, title, [9], 406 pp, [1] printers marque, 19 B&W full page illustrations, t.e.g., remainder uncut. There were also 450 ordinary copies on mould-made paper). Accompanied by a black portfolio, containing 14 additional full page illustrations, all pencil signed & mounted within cream paper leaves. Book & Portfolio each with a book label to fpd (Stoughton R. Vogel, M.D.), all housed together in the original large black cloth double slipcase, a trifle worn. Book 337*219mm; Prints 337*223mm; Slipcase 362*246 mm), wood engravings, respectively by Blair Hughes-Stanton, Gertrude Hermes, Leon Underwood, Stephen Gooden, Rene Ben Sussan, M. E. Groom, Eric Jones, Wladislaw Skocaylas, Hester Sainsbury, Frank Medworth, Eric Kennington, Eric Ravilious, John Nash & D. Galanis. A remarkable suite of illustrations, including many of the foremost illustrators of the period, printed at the Curwen Press. The Cresset Press was an imprint founded by Dennis Cohen who published several finely printed and illustrated books over four years between 1927 and 1931. Some of these are among the finest productions of the period. Signed by Illustrator(s).

First edition, printed at the Curwen Press and limited to 450 numbered copies on mould-made paper, plus a further thirty deluxe copies (this one of the 450 examples, but un-numbered). Large 4to. 406pp. Bound in full brown buckram with two red leather spine labels, lettered and bordered in gold (this binding unusual as the 'correct' binding should be white vellum; the fact that this example is un-numbered may suggest that it was intended as a trial or proof copy, or perhaps a file copy). Fore- and bottom edges untrimmed. A touch of very light spotting to the edges and endpapers, and to very occasional leaf margins. Backstrip ends very gently rubbed. A very good copy of an uncommon and quite delightful production: a tour-de-force collaboration featuring some of the finest wood engravers of the post-Great War period, each one tackling one of the fourteen books classified as apocryphal by the King James Bible.
